Web24 nov. 2024 · Radioactive iodine treatment is a therapy that your veterinary surgeon may recommend if your cat is diagnosed with hyperthyroidism. Hyperthyroidism, or an overactive thyroid, is a common disease of older cats. Affected cats produce too much thyroid hormone. Thyroid hormone regulates the metabolic rate of an animal. Web• This is a Low-Iodine Diet, not a No-Iodine Diet or an Iodine-Free Diet. • The goal is to take less than 50 mcg iodine per day. • The diet is for a short time period, for the 2 weeks before a radioactive iodine treatment and 2 day after treatment. • Avoid foods high in iodine (over 20 mcg per serving). Web6 okt. 2024 · There are mainly 3 different options, often used in the raw feeding community: kelp, iodine drops, iodized salt. While iodized salt isn't harmful, I do not recommend it as both sodium and chloride are already covered in a PMR raw diet. Let’s talk about the two other options: kelp and iodine drops. Kelp

WebRAI is a form of treatment for hyperthyroidism in cats and is considered to be the safest and most effective treatment for this condition. It is most commonly administered as cats with hyperthyroidism can be difficult to give medications to.
